It is 1814 and war is still raging between France and England. Thirteen-year-old Max is a powder monkey aboard the HMS Wind, a British warship. His captain is in pursuit of a phantom French frigate, and he will stop at nothing to find it. When they reach the other side of the world, the French are discovered and battle breaks out at sea. Merciless cannons tear both of the warships to shreds right before a storm hits. Left with the choice to either sink along with his burning ship, or make the impossible swim to The Galapagos islands, Max barely makes it to foreign lands alive. He soon discovers an enemy lying on the shore, but the French boy's face is burned so badly that he can no longer see. Far away from their homes, the war, and their countrymen, Max and his new companion fight to survive in their new reality at the end of the world.
